What factors determine the fluctuation of block prices in the cryptocurrency market?

- Glow-codingNov 08, 2024 · 8 months agoThe fluctuation of block prices in the cryptocurrency market is influenced by several key factors. Firstly, market demand and supply play a significant role. When there is high demand for a particular cryptocurrency, its price tends to increase. Conversely, when there is low demand or a surplus supply, the price may decrease. Additionally, market sentiment and investor speculation can greatly impact block prices. News, events, and regulatory changes related to cryptocurrencies can cause significant price fluctuations. Moreover, the overall market conditions, such as the performance of major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, can also influence block prices. Lastly, technological advancements, upgrades, and improvements in blockchain technology can affect the value of cryptocurrencies and subsequently impact block prices.
